  • Size of the image changes when you move an image between Lightroom and CC.

    Size of the image changes when you move an image between Lightroom and CC.

    I opened a .dng image in LR and then opened it in the develop module.  I clicked on Crop Overlay and then on the "As Shot" (the lock is closed) menu drop-down and cropped to 11 x 17 and click 'Done '-.

    I click Ctrl-E and the image opens in the CC.  I click on the Image > Image size and the size of the Image is 13,288 inches on 20,533.

    Why change the size of the image?

    I believe that there is a menu to control the size of the image, and I've looked everywhere I see in LR and CC, I have googled various descriptions and I checked both Kelby books, but I can't understand not just how to keep the image at a uniform height when moving between LR and CC.

    Help!... Please?

    The size of the image has not changed. The number of pixels has not changed. Let me tell you. The number of pixels has not changed to a single pixel.

    The numbers relatively meaningless displayed by your software have changed.

    The image is always format 11 x 17 (17 divided by 11 = 1.545 and 20.533 divided by 13.288 = 1.545)

  • How can I disable the function that copies the image files when you drag the mouse?

    When I go to my image files and I hold down the Ctlr key and highlight a series of photos to remove, I sometimes inadvertently made my mouse to other photos and cause a series of copies to reach. He is a frequent source of frustration. How can disable this feature of "copy"?

    When I go to my image files and I hold down the Ctlr key and highlight a series of photos to remove, I sometimes inadvertently made my mouse to other photos and cause a series of copies to reach. He is a frequent source of frustration. How can disable this feature of "copy"?

    =============================================
    If you are comfortable editing the registry, the
    more info can be your solution.

    I do not have an article with the specific steps
    Windows 7, but the following link should provide
    enough information to help you improve the issue.

    (FWIW... it's always a good idea to create a system)
    Restore point before editing the registry)

    Trouble fixing: stop Windows copy
    Files accidentally when Ctrl-click selecting
    http://www.howtogeek.com/HOWTO/Windows-Vista/fixing-annoyances-stop-Windows-from-copying-files-accidentally-when-CTRL-click-selecting/

    Changing the default value in the following keys
    from 4 to 20 is supposed to improve the problem.

    H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Control Panel\Desktop\DragHeight
    H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Control Panel\Desktop\DragWidth
